IP List distribution Last Shift (2014) [BluRay] [1080p] [YTS.LT], total 3
IP Country City ISP
41.254.64.121 Libya General Post and Telecommunication Company
41.254.75.45 Libya General Post and Telecommunication Company
41.254.76.174 Libya General Post and Telecommunication Company